Meet walk leader, Andrew Bramhall, by the front of the Knot Inn, Rushton Spencer. SK11 0KU / Grid Ref SJ 936 624.Car Parking: There is a small public car park (not the pub car park) just past the Knot Inn. https://maps.app.goo.gl/Lwrcw4fSww7jFQLs8
Info: Discover a classic Staffordshire Moorlands circular walk from Rushton Spencer. We’ll head out to the historic Chapel in the Wilderness, then descend to the waterside trails of Rudyard Lake. From there, the route threads across open fields and hidden linking paths before heading up onto Gun Moor for big-sky panoramas across the Cheshire Plains, Staffordshire and beyond. We finish by The Knot Inn, perfectly placed for a well-earned drink for anyone who wants to stay on afterwards.
